Blake Lively & Justin Baldoni To Meet In Settlement Talks Next Month, But No Progress Expected As Trial Looms

Blake Lively and Justin Baldoni Lawyers for Blake Lively and Justin Baldoni are officially talking about coming to some sort of settlement in the bitter and sprawling sex harassment and retaliation legal action the actress launched last year against her It Ends With Us co-star and his Wayfarer Studios inner circle. Of course, no one on either side has high hopes that the parties can come to any deal before the scheduled start of the trial in May 2026. “This is a mix of going through the motions, fulfilling Judge [Lewis] Liman’s order and putting the best foot forward,” an individual close to the matter told Deadline this week as a settlement calendar appeared on the federal court docket.
